Subject[PATCH 0/3] UIO: cleanup and platform driver
Hello,

there are three patches left in my uio queue that didn't made it into
mainline up to now.

You can find the patches in my uio branch at

git://www.modarm9.com/gitsrc/pub/people/ukleinek/linux-2.6.git uio

and I will resend the patches as a reply to this mail.

Shortlog and diffstat can be found below.

Best regards
Uwe

Uwe Kleine-König (3):
UIO: don't let UIO_CIF and UIO_SMX depend twice on UIO
provide a dummy implementation of the clk API
UIO: generic platform driver

drivers/uio/Kconfig | 10 +++-
drivers/uio/Makefile | 1 +
drivers/uio/uio_pdrv.c | 155 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
lib/Kconfig | 6 ++
lib/Makefile | 2 +
lib/dummyclk.c | 54 +++++++++++++++++
6 files changed, 226 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
